Selasa, 06 September 2011

 Ini program Menghitung nilai minimal ke-1 dan ke-2 bersertakan nilai rata-ratanya. program ini bisa diikuti dan didownload di http://www.mediafire.com/?0y6eltikd3z09sg
import java.util.*;

import java.util.Scanner;
public class MinRat
{
    public static void main(String[]args)
    {
        Scanner s = new Scanner(System.in);
        int nilai_input = 0,jml_bilangan = 0, a = 0, b = 0;
        double average = 0, total_av = 0;
       
        System.out.print("Masukkan jumlah bilangan yang akan di input: ");
        jml_bilangan = s.nextInt();
       
        System.out.print("Nilai 1 : ");
        nilai_input = s.nextInt();
       
        a = nilai_input;
        average = nilai_input;
        for(int i = 2; i <= jml_bilangan; i++)
        {
                System.out.print("Nilai "+i+" : ");
                nilai_input = s.nextInt();
                average += nilai_input;
                if(nilai_input < a)
                    {
                        b = a;
                        a = nilai_input;
                       
                    }
                else if (nilai_input < b)
                    {
                        b = nilai_input;
                    }
               
        }
        total_av = average/jml_bilangan;
        System.out.println("Nilai Paling kecil adalah : "+a);
        System.out.println("Nilai kecil kedua : "+b);
        System.out.println("Rata-rata  : "+total_av);
   
    }
}
Tampilannya ....
Read more

Descending

Ini program yang saya berinama Descending, program ini dapat anda coba dan bisa anda download di http://www.mediafire.com/?k148mmq35l7lx6v

import java.util.*;
public class Descending
{
        public static void main(String[]args)
        {
            int bil_input = 0;
            int [] input = new int[100];
            int des1 = 0;
            int des2 = 0;
            int des3 = 0;
           
            Scanner s = new Scanner(System.in);
                System.out.print("Masukan jumlah bilangan yang akan di input: ");
                bil_input = s.nextInt();
           
            for(int a=1; a<=bil_input; a++ )
                {
                    System.out.print("bilangan ke "+a+" : ");
                    input [a] = s.nextInt();
                }
            for(int a=1; a<=bil_input; a++ )
                {
                    des1 = input[a];
                    for(int b=a; b<=bil_input; b++)
                        {
                            if(input[b]>=des1)
                            {
                                des1 = input[b];
                                des2=b;
                            }
                        }
                    des3 = input[a];
                    input[a] = input[des2] ;
                    input[des2] = des3;
                }       
                    System.out.print("Hasil : ");
                        for(int a=1; a<=bil_input; a++)
                        {
                            System.out.print(""+input[a]+" ");
                        }
    }
}



Read more

Daftar Blog Saya

Sample Text

Top Menu

Blogger news

Diberdayakan oleh Blogger.
 

grata blog Shari Design by Insight © 2009